IToolbar::GetButtonState メソッド (mmc.h)
IToolbar::GetButtonState メソッドを使用すると、スナップインでボタンの属性を取得できます。
構文
HRESULT GetButtonState(
[in] int idCommand,
[in] MMC_BUTTON_STATE nState,
[out] BOOL *pState
);
パラメーター
[in] idCommand
ツール バー ボタンのコマンド識別子。
[in] nState
ボタンの使用可能な状態を識別する 値。 以下のいずれかを指定できます。
ENABLED
ボタンはユーザー入力を受け入れます。 この状態ではないボタンは、ユーザー入力を受け付けず、淡色表示になります。
CHECKED
ボタンには CHECKED スタイルがあり、押されています。
HIDDEN
ボタンは表示されず、ユーザー入力を受信できません。
不確定
ボタンが淡色表示されます。
BUTTONPRESSED
ボタンが押されています。
[out] pState
返される状態情報へのポインター。
戻り値
このメソッドは、これらの値のいずれかを返すことができます。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ows Vista |
サポートされている最小のサーバー | Windows Server 2008 |
対象プラットフォーム | Windows |
ヘッダー | mmc.h |
[DLL] | Mmcndmgr.dll |